Economy Fair with 212 Exhibitors opened in Skenderija Centre

Published December 15, 2017
Share
SHARE

“The Fair of Economy, Agriculture, Crafts and Consumer Goods 2017” was opened yesterday in Skenderija Center, and it will gather 212 exhibitors from the entire BiH.

The motto of this fair is “Domestic Product in the Service of Citizens of BiH” and it represents an opportunity for presentation of several fields of economic activities in one place, and it also gives great opportunity to visitors to take a look at what BH economy can offer.

“We have 212 exhibitors this year and their number is growing each year. The exhibitors are coming from the entire BiH, and besides businessmen, we also have economic associations. A large number of cantons and municipalities is participating in the fair as well and all of them represent business subjects and products from those areas,” stated the director of the PUC Centar Skenderija, Amer Kapo.

The topic of traditional food and tourism, with special emphasis on the production of cheese and valorisation of typical BH products, will be discussed within the expert-educational program of the fair. Moreover, the conditions, obligations and perspectives of exports of foods with animal origin from BiH will be discussed as well.

Entrepreneurial and educational center “Networks” will present some more innovative contents, including new technologies (3D printers), robotics, and a special attention will be given to the development of small business companies and IT.

The fair will last until December 16, and the entrance for visitors is free of charge.
